62 of 151 menu

Metod seed modula random

Metod seed modula random inicializuje ili čuva određeni slučajni broj. Za generisanje slučajnih brojeva metod koristi trenutno sistemsko vreme OS. Metod seed primenjuje se pre metoda random. U neobaveznom parametru metoda prosleđuje se broj za inicializaciju ili svojevrsno označavanje generisanog broja. Stoga pri ponovnoj primeni metoda random generisani broj se ne menja. Ako se parametar ostavi prazan, tada će se generisati svaki put novi broj.

Sintaksa

import random random.seed(broj za označavanje)

Primer

Hajde da inicijalizujemo broj pre njegovog generisanja:

random.seed(5) print(random.random())

Rezultat izvršenja koda:

0.6229016948897019

Hajde da ponovimo ispis našeg broja:

random.seed(5) print(random.random()) random.seed(5) print(random.random())

Rezultat će ostati isti:

0.6229016948897019 0.6229016948897019

Pogledajte takođe

  • metod random modula random,
    koji vraća pseudo-slučajan broj
  • metod uniform modula random,
    koji generiše pseudo-slučajan realan broj iz opsega
  • metod randint modula random,
    koji generiše pseudo-slučajan ceo broj iz opsega
  • metod randrange modula random,
    koji vraća slučajan broj iz opsega
Srpski
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ართულიҚазақ한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Koristimo kolačiće za rad sajta, analitiku i personalizaciju. Obrada podataka se vrši u skladu sa Politikom privatnosti.
prihvati sve podesi odbij